Abstract

E-learning paves the way to a new type of course, more student centred, granulized, on demand, and highly interactive. Natural Language Processing (NLP) technologies associated with other multimedia technologies can help to address the major issues raised by this new type of courses: interaction, personalization and reliable information access. This paper presents Exills, a true e-learning solution which integrates natural language processing tools and virtual reality. Exills is unique in that unlike most of the language learning systems, it focuses on improving learners' performance rather than learners' competence.
